So, how can you tell between a 4 cyl and 8 cyl box from a picture?
 
The easiest way I can think of is the bellhousing on the 2000 box has a big lump to accomodate the bendix of an inertia starter.If you're unsure post a picture or a link to the ebay item and I'll soon tell you.

Since the V8 boxes were just beefed up 4 cyl boxes i was always thinking that these should be interchangeable, if you swap the bellhousings of course. Perhaps they have different input shafts too?
 
That's the one
and there's no way they're interchangeable, even if you could just remove the bellhousings (which you can't) the main casings are different as well. You can use parts from the 4 cyl boxes in the 3500S ones but only if you know what and where. In other words, don't even think about it! :D
 
yep defo a early 4 cyl gearbox..v8 the starter is on the other side and below the centre line..
